Cabinet of Ministers Regulations No. 410, Riga, 14 June 2005 (pr. No 35) amendment of the Cabinet of Ministers of 20 March 2001 No. 139 "the terms of the order in which the national authorities and the officials obtain information from the land registry of the country-wide computerised" Issued under the Land Registry Act 134. the second paragraph of article do Cabinet of 20 March 2001 No. 139 "the terms of the order in which the national authorities and the officials obtain information from the land registry of the country-wide computerised" (Latvian journal, 2001, 52 no; 2003 141., 45, no; in 2004, 116 no). 2. amendments and make the point as follows: "2. The right to the land registry information service is to State control, the constitutional protection Office, the national police, the security police, the National Guard, the Prosecutor General's Office, the military intelligence and security service, State revenue service, the State Agency" insolvency administration ", the Court, in a sworn bailiff, sworn notary, corruption prevention and combating Bureau, the maintenance guarantee fund administration and Criminal money laundering prevention service (hereinafter referred to as the national authority)."
